The Bible plays a central role in shaping the beliefs and practices of Christianity. It is considered the sacred text that contains the teachings and stories of Jesus Christ and serves as a guide for moral and ethical behavior. Christians look to the Bible for guidance on how to live their lives in accordance with the teachings of Jesus and the principles of their faith.
